Created in the silent and marshy Sologne region, Chambord’s domain of 5,400 hectares, surrounded by a 20-mile-long wall, is the largest enclosed forest in Europe. Outside the UNESCO World Heritage-listed Loire Valley region, but still on the banks of the river, is Camping de Nevers. The site, like the town it’s based by, is a little smaller than those in the Loire Valley proper – and some campers may prefer it for this. WebJan 24, 2024 · The Loire River is over 600 miles long and runs from the Massif Céntral mountains in Southeast France, and ends on France’s west coast. It empties into the Bay of Biscay in the Atlantic Ocean in the town of Saint-Nazare. Parts of the region are World Heritage Sites, meaning they have important cultural and historic significance. Web4. Château du Clos-Lucé. Any list of the best Loire Valley castles would be remiss not to mention Clos Lucé. Leonardi da Vinci’s famed home from 1516 to 1519, this Loire castle is a testament to the esteemed artist and inventor who took his last breaths here.
